This is a Front Gear Cover Gasket designed to seal the front gear housing on Cummins 6C8.3 engines, commonly found in Hyundai R290Lc-7 and Volvo EC240 excavators. It is manufactured to meet stringent material and dimensional standards, ensuring a leak-free seal that prevents oil and contaminant ingress, unlike a worn or damaged gasket which would allow fluid loss and debris entry. Operators may notice oil leaks around the front of the engine, a potential decrease in oil pressure, or a burning oil smell if this gasket fails.

Initial signs of failure include visible oil seepage or small drips from the front of the engine, particularly around the timing gear cover. If left unaddressed, the leak can worsen, leading to significant oil loss and potential lubrication issues for critical engine components. Continued operation with a severe leak risks insufficient lubrication for the crankshaft and camshaft, potentially causing premature wear or damage.
Ensure the gasket mating surfaces on both the engine block and the gear cover are perfectly clean and free of old gasket material or debris before installation. Avoid overtightening the gear cover bolts, as this can distort the gasket and lead to leaks.
Inspect the crankshaft front seal and camshaft front seal for signs of wear or leakage and replace if necessary.
